POMONE PARIS created by a chemical engineer, Florence Selling. Pomone integrates the most recent discoveries of science and cosmetology in sensual formulas. Having met various visions of beauty, from France to South America, the founder is convinced that beauty is all encompassing. The conservatory of biodiversity, offered by the closed gardens of the Castle of Canon, inspires the choice of Pomone’s active ingredients. The Pomone formulas exclude parabens, phenoxyethanol, silicones and mineral oils.
Floral, fresh and green fragrance of Pomone skincare products evokes the gardens of the Castle and gives a feeling of bucolic escape. It has been conceived by a perfumer of the city of Grasse, with Ecocert and natural raw materials.
I received the Cream Mask, a smooth texture rich in efficient active ingredients. A mask intended to target the signs of age, firmness of the skin and provides immediate relaxation and visible benefit. The face recovers its serenity.
Inci list: apple polyphenols, powerful anti-oxidants – apple quercetin, activates sirtuins and fights against glication of proteins – malic acid extracted from the apple, firming and smoothing properties – apple seeds oil, nutritive and revitalizing – apple vegetal water or original extract, energizing and source of essential oils, oligo-elements and mineral salts.

SAISONS D’EDEN is the story of a woman fascinated by plants and convinced that our bodies change with the different seasons. Our skin, which is the first organ to be confronted with these climatic changes, needs to be adequately prepared.
Johanna Fayolle decides to abandon her PowerPoint presentations and dry consultant files and to dedicate herself to the research of what nature can offer our skin, with the objective of reconciling Nature and Progress, Health and Refinement.
She creates her skin care line in collaboration with a state-of-the-art laboratory. Her priority being to recognize and integrate the influence of the changing seasons with the need for an ethical high performance. These standards are at the heart of Saisons D’Eden’s philosophy, along with respect for skin type and the use of organic ingredients, without compromise.
I received the Eye Contour Gel which claims to be highly concentrated, perfume-free, with a gel-cream texture, with eye lifting properties (Ginseng extract). An anti-fatigue smoothened aimed to reduce bags and swollen eyes. Also claims to be hydrating to provide the indispensable ingredients for cell structure around eyes.
I also received the Spring Summer moisturizer strong on antioxidants and essential fatty acids (Raspberry and Sesame seed oils) intended to plump and hydrate skin while controlling sebum production. Smells very indulgent with discreet raspberry and white grapefruit fragrance.

Les Interchangeables has a wonderful story about a girl (founder) Audrey. As a girl, Audrey was always designing and creating on her sewing machine, with a deep-seated passion for the decorative arts. She launched her first endeavor in 2007 – an ingenious concept of interchangeable, decorative bra straps. Designed to be shown, rather than hidden, the idea was a huge success as it addressed an issue that all women could relate to.
Eventually, she approached Swarovski to partner with her to develop a new concept – the creation of a line of stretchable, adjustable bracelets decorated with crystals. Imaginative, playful and luxe, the line developed quickly and acquired “must have” status in the accessories category in France and throughout Europe.
By 2014, Les Interchangeables had become a juggernaut, with a full accessories collection and an international presence with over 2,000 points of sale all over the world, including Italy, Spain, Korea, Japan, China, Australia, Canada, United Arab Emirates, and the United States. Today, Audrey continues to innovate in the accessory space – she always has a new approach, a unique twist on accessible, luxurious and functional fashion.

July of St. Barth founded in 1989 by Juliette Espinasse, the brand specializes in the creation of hats, bags, perfumes and beauty products, combining lifestyle and luxury in the French. For 20 years Juliet sews on her hats the shellfish found on Shell Beach, her favorite beach in St. Barts where she lived for several years.
As a part of this box, I received the Shell Beach body soap, which is made according to the traditional method of Marseille, with a base of coconut oil and olive oil. The formula is free of EDTA and parabens.
